Average Pharr electricity rate based on kWh usage
Pharr electricity rates are structured based on usage in kilowatt-hours (kWh). For residential consumers, the average purchase price at each usage level is as follows:
- 19.83 cents for 500 kWh.
- 14.57 cents for 1000 kWh.
- 16.31 cents for 2000 kWh.

Energy providers and utility companies in Pharr
The energy providers available in your neighborhood purchase electricity. The utility company, on the other hand, manages the delivery of that power. The utility is also in charge of restoring power outages and repairing equipment.
- Utility company in Pharr: The utility in Pharr is AEP Central. You cannot choose your utility company — your address determines your utility provider.
- Electric companies in Pharr: You have the power to choose your energy provider in Pharr. Trusted providers include TXU Energy, TriEagle Energy, Gexa Energy, and more.
Power outages in Pharr
The utility company Pharr is responsible for delivering electricity to your home. It also maintains power lines and handle outages. If you lose power in your home or business, you don’t want to call your retail energy provider. Instead, get in touch with the local utility (AEP Central) to alert them.
- In Pharr, the utility company is AEP.

How weather affects Pharr electricity rates
Electricity rates in Pharr change throughout the year based on various factors, including the weather. Average temperatures in Pharr reach 97 and 98 degrees Fahrenheit in July and August, respectively. The summer heat can lead to an increase in energy demand and prices as people cool their homes. No-deposit electric supply plans in Pharr
These plans don’t ask for a deposit or a credit check. They are usually pre-paid and can be a useful temporary solution for people who don’t want to lock into a long-term plan or can’t get approved for one.
Fixed-rate supply plans in Pharr
This type of electricity plan offers a consistent supply rate for the duration of your contract with the retail electricity provider. Your rate won’t fluctuate with the wholesale cost of energy.
Variable-rate supply plans in Pharr
If you have a variable-rate plan, you’ll pay electricity based on the wholesale price of energy. This agreement can lead to fluctuations in energy rates on your bill from month to month or season to season.
Green electricity in Pharr
Some energy plans that serve Pharr get part or all of their generated energy from green sources. Green energy reduces your carbon footprint and can keep prices low.
